Design a Sustainable Gingerbread House



150_GingerbreadBake for a Change is a design competition that asks you to apply sustainable building design practices to a gingerbread house. The rules:

1) Everything must be edible.

2) However half-baked (har har), there must be at least FOUR identifiable sustainable building design elements.

3) Your design must include a minimum of a floor, a door, four walls, a roof, and two windows.

You can submit your design description and photos to a Flickr group or email them in by December 31st. The top three entrants will win a t-shirt. Link -via The World’s Fair
